Output 16bbda9435d4b8b6368987c813949d447bf0cd1b62e846ffc876712b0816ecc9:1

value
2600026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94ef169dd79d9c71c5665db7e5e6b739c18aec0 OP_EQUAL
address
3L3SKAB2dYDP6u5cjWmPMKWhVMVhXfTv3n
transaction
16bbda9435d4b8b6368987c813949d447bf0cd1b62e846ffc876712b0816ecc9
spent
true